Soil and climate around Carlock

Ground around Carlock runs to clay, loam and sandy loam, which shapes how quickly water- or air-based excavation cuts and how the spoil is handled. Illinois winters bring frost to roughly 36" of depth around Carlock, so cold-weather digs here often favor air excavation or heated-water hydrovac to work frozen ground. Carlock sits in a temperate climate, which sets the seasonal window for excavation here. Before you dig in Carlock

Illinois requires a JULIE (Joint Utility Locating Information for Excavators) locate before excavation, and Carlock is no exception, so request marks at 811 ahead of time. Illinois requires 48 hours notice; Chicago area has additional requirements. Every service provider we connect you with treats utility location as a standard part of the job, not an afterthought.

Which type of vacuum truck do I need for my job in Carlock?

It depends on the work: hydrovac and air vacuum trucks dig safely around utilities, combo trucks clean sewers and pipes, and liquid or liquid-ring units recover fluids and slurry. Describe your Carlock job and we match it to service providers with the right equipment.
